The open-drain output means the gate can only pull the output low; a pull-up resistor to the desired logic voltage sets the high level, which allows wired-AND connections or level translation to a higher-voltage bus without an external translator. Each of the four independent gates accepts two inputs. The Schmitt-trigger hysteresis cleans up slow or noisy edges — a 1V to 3V low-level threshold versus a 1.5V to 4.2V high-level threshold gives about 0.5V of typical hysteresis across the 2V to 6V supply range. ## Supply range, temperature grade, and quiescent draw Rated for 2V to 6V supply, the part covers 3.3V and 5V logic rails without a separate regulator. The -40°C to 125°C operating range spans industrial and automotive ambient — the 125°C ceiling covers under-hood and engine-bay environments where standard 85°C logic would derate. Quiescent current maxes at 2 µA across the full voltage and temperature range. For a battery-powered sensor node that spends most of its life in standby, the gate's own draw is negligible — the pull-up resistor on the open-drain output will dominate the idle current budget. Propagation delay is 16 ns typical at 6V with a 50 pF load. The open-drain output's rise time is set by the external pull-up resistor and load capacitance, not by the gate itself — a 1 kΩ pull-up into 50 pF adds about 55 ns of RC rise, which sets the practical data rate ceiling more than the 16 ns propagation delay. ## Package and sourcing posture Housed in a 14-TSSOP package (4.40 mm body width, 0.65 mm pin pitch), the SN74HCS266PWR is a surface-mount part suited for dense PCB layouts.
